Output 07dd86b759927c2b7efce97f3bd0b6df93ef87c35e7c8aa1ff2ff8151ec2d062:2

value
17858104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ccfb07174165dc6483b69505732e8f70ef2461d OP_EQUAL
address
3EXZKuCU8xbvYiuHjW1waaovZnoLvCxXty
transaction
07dd86b759927c2b7efce97f3bd0b6df93ef87c35e7c8aa1ff2ff8151ec2d062
confirmations
220392
spent
true